About G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E

Set in ST. LOUIS, Missouri, G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E is a low-enrollment intermediate school, overseen by CONFLUENCE ACADEMIES. It works with 218 students across grades 6 through 8. Enrollment runs roughly 53% smaller than the state mean of about 461.

G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E is one of 6 schools operated by CONFLUENCE ACADEMIES, a district that caters to 2,460 students overall.

In terms of who attends, G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E lists that 78% of the student body identifies as Black. Beyond that, the school records 17% White, 2% multiracial. The wider county runs roughly 42% Black, putting the school's mix considerably more Black than the area baseline.

Looking at the economic backdrop, The school currently runs with 19 full-time-equivalent teachers, for a student-teacher ratio near 11.3:1.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 13.0:1, putting G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E tighter than the state norm the norm. An estimated 100% of students are eligible for free or reduced-price lunch, a number frequently used as a low-income enrollment indicator.

After controlling for student poverty, G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E sits in the middle band of the BeatsExpectations distribution. Schools with this campus's student mix typically land near 49.4%; this one delivers 29.9%.

Across the wider county, census data for St. Louis city shows the typical household earns roughly $56,160 per year, 41%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 15%. Across St. Louis city's 113 public schools (combined enrollment of about 29,941 students), G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E is one campus in the mix.

GRAND CENTER ARTS ACADEMY HIGH is the nearest neighboring public school, about 0.0 miles from this campus. 8 of the 8 nearest public schools sit inside a five-mile radius. Among the 8 schools in that immediate cluster with test data (this one included), G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E ranks 8th on composite proficiency, below the local average of 51.6%.

Geographically, the school is in a metropolitan area. GRAND CENTER ARTS ACAD MIDDLE operates as a public charter school, meaning it is publicly funded but governed independently of the surrounding district's traditional schools.
